Time is ripe for startups around the world to capitalise on Malaysia's potential as the heart of Digital ASEAN: MDEC's Surina Shukri
Note: This article was originally published in e27 on 11 February 2020. Economic Research Institute for ASEAN and East Asia was mentioned
Malaysia has been actively rolling out business-friendly initiatives and policies to encourage higher foreign direct investment. GAIN, a programme launched in 2015 by the Malaysia Digital Economy Corporation (MDEC), aims to provide end-to-end expansion support to local companies.
